
CO2 meter, also been called as CO2 detector or Carbon Dioxide detector, it’s the device that can detect the presence of Carbon Dioxide (CO2), which had been widely used for indoor air quality measurement.
AZ7787 CO2 & Temperature & Relative Humidity Monitor was being designed and manufactured by AZ Instrument, a well experienced manufacturer for Environmental Measuring Instrument.
Specification | |
Measuring range | |
CO2 | 0~9999 ppm,(2001~9999 ppm out of scale range) |
Temperature | -10~60 °C (14~140 °F) |
Relative Humidity | 0.1%~99.9%RH |
Resolution | 1ppm , 0.1 °C/ °F, 0.1%RH |
Accuracy | |
CO2 | +50ppm+5% of reading( 0~2000ppm) Other ranges accuracy are not specified |
Temperature | ±0.6 °C/+0.9 °F |
Relative Humidity | ±3%RH(at 25 °C, 10~90%RH) ±5%RH( at 25 °C,others ) |
Warm-up time | 30 seconds |
Response time | |
CO2 | <2 minutes ( 90% step change) |
Tair | <2 mins (90% step change) |
RH | <10 minutes ( 90% step change) |
RELAY(1A 30VDC/0.5A 125VAC) | YES |
LCD size (mm, HxW) | 60x82 |
Operating condition | 0~50 °C , 5~80% RH (avoid condensation) |
Storage condition | -20~ 50 °C,5~90%RH(avoid condensation) |
Power supply | 5VDC adaptor (±10%), >=500mA |
Meter size | 120 x 80 mm (Diameter x Depth) |
Weight | 200g |
Standard package | Meter, manual,5V universal adaptor, plain box |
AZ7787 CO2 Datalogger features:
- Digital desktop type gives you a green day
- 15 degree tilt angle for easy to see and read
- Real time clock and calendar are displayed
- Warning carbon dioxide level from 1000-5000ppm
- Super large LCD display CO2 value, Temp., Humidity, Date and Time
- Max. / Min. Recall Function
- Temperature unit is switchable
- NDIR (Non-Dispersive Infrared) waveguide tec
- With ABC (Automatic Background Calibration)
- Long time drift compensation
- Bright LED visible indicates power is on
- Audible alarm warns CO2 air quality is poor
- Monitoring residential, commercial and home air quality
- CO2 alarm output design drives relay to control ventilation system, such as fan or air conditioner
